How much do market risk man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 26, 2026, the average yearly pay for market risk manager in Norwalk, CT is $111,977.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$90,300.00 and $129,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Market Risk Manager do?

A Market Risk Manager is responsible for identifying, assessing, and mitigating risks that arise from fluctuations in market variables such as interest rates, foreign exchange rates, and equity prices. They analyze trading portfolios, conduct stress tests, and develop risk management strategies to protect their organization from potential losses. Additionally, Market Risk Managers work closely with traders, analysts, and senior management to ensure that market risks are understood and maintained within acceptable levels.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Market Risk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Market Risk Manager, you need strong quantitative analysis skills, a background in finance or economics, and often an advanced degree such as an MBA or CFA. Familiarity with risk management software (like Value-at-Risk models), statistical tools, and financial systems such as Bloomberg Terminal is typically required. Excellent problem-solving, communication, and decision-making skills set standout candidates apart in this highly analytical role. These capabilities are crucial for accurately assessing market risks, supporting sound investment decisions, and ensuring regulatory compliance in dynamic financial environments.

How does a Market Risk Manager typically collaborate with other departments within a financial institution?

A Market Risk Manager works closely with various departments such as trading, treasury, and compliance to monitor and mitigate potential risks in the institution’s portfolio. They often consult with traders to understand new products and exposures, coordinate with IT teams to enhance risk management systems, and report findings to senior management and regulatory bodies. Regular communication and collaboration are essential to ensure all teams are aligned in managing risk effectively and responding promptly to market developments.

Overview
The position is within Market Risk Management, which is responsible for managing trading and fair value banking book risk for a breath of primary and secondary credit and equity businesses including Credit/Equity Trading, Origination, Financing, as well as Residential Mortgage-Backed Security (RMBS), Securitization, Commercial Real Estate (CRE) within Deutsche Bank.
Market Risk Management (MRM) carries out this responsibility independently providing a comprehensive view of market risks to Senior Management. The professional will ensure that Business units of the Bank optimize the risk-reward relationship and do not expose the firm to unacceptable losses. We are looking for a Self-motivated professional who can work well in a fast-paced environment, collaborating within a team, and interacting with traders, quants, research, etc. on a daily basis. Prior experience with cash and derivative equity and/or fixed income products is preferred.

What You'll Do
  • Set appropriate Risk Appetites for each business level and sit with the traders, communicate risk strategies and monitor and manage risk real time on a daily basis
  • Monitor intraday and daily limit utilizations, evaluate limit frameworks, and communicate risk exposure and breaches to front office as well as senior risk management
  • Analyze key market risk metrics including Value at Risk (VaR), Stress Test, Risk Weighted Assets (RWA), and advise business on effective hedging strategies
  • Preapprove equity financing transactions such as call spreads, collars, margin loans, and accelerated share repurchases ahead of desk bidding, including pretrade analysis and approval recommendations for on-risk block trades
  • Support Comprehensive Capital Analysis Review (CCAR) quarterly, semi-annual, and annual reporting requirements. Evaluate portfolio capital efficiencies and identify positions with material Risk Weighted Assets (RWA) and stress utilizations
  • Ensure internal and external governance policies are being effectively applied

How You'll Lead
  • Market Risk Management: highlighting key risks and new important trades/products and escalating emerging risks, concentrated positions, and any risk position that is particularly vulnerable to plausible stress scenarios or current market conditions
  • Front Office: challenging the desk on the aforementioned set of risks and work cooperatively to allow the growth of the Business within the Firm risk appetite
  • Portfolio and Stress Testing team working together with these teams to ensure the key risk positions of the Business covered are well represented in their aggregated metrics
